520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. From the outbreak of French colonization up to the economic crisis in 1912, companies from several European countries settled in Côte d’Ivoire. The setting up of a hierarchical system and the choice of assistants were a few organizational aspects that rationalized their profits. But the weakness of the commercial diversification, the exorbitant overheads, and the lack of control over their management meant that many of them ended up failing.
